Abstract
The reaction of Cp-2*Co-2(CO)(2) 1 (Cp* = C5Me4Et) with equimolar amounts o f As4Se4 was investigated at different temperatures and compared to the rea ction of 1 with As4S4. In boiling toluene the formation of Cp-2*Co2As2Se3 ( 4-Se) and Cp-3*Co3As2Se4 (5-Se) was observed, whereas in boiling xylene in addition to 4-Se and 5-Se Cp*CoAs6Se (7) was formed. Spectroscopic investig ations show that the structures of 4-Se and 5-Se are analogous to those of the known compounds Cp-2*Co2As2S3 (4-S) and Cp-3*Co3As2S4 (5-S). As 7 is th e first complex derived from selenium substituted E-7(3-) (E = P, As, Sb) Z intl ions, an X-ray diffraction analysis was carried out showing that it co nsists of a norbornadiene-like cage of the main group elements to which a C p*Co fragment is coordinated via four As atoms as a four-electron ligand.
